Wayne, you are talking about a reasonable effort and significant cost
regardless of the material chosen, Do not use aluminum, it is far too
reactive. Do not use gavanized steel. The diesel will disolve the zinc.

The
ultimate material should be 316TI SS and next best would be mild steel
blasted and painted with the special Permatex tank paint. This paint is
designed for large storage tanks and must be ordered specially. I just
finished 2 water tanks slightly smaller than yours in stainless and the
material cost was $3200 and that included access hatches.

Commercial small / medium size vessel practice is usually aluminum or mild
steel. I don't see using plastic tanks, the size you are suggesting is
pretty big for plastic of non cylindrical shapes.

Saying aluminum is "too reactive" isn't really true. The only problem

with
aluminum is if the tank is let to sit with moisture trapped against it.
Stand-offs or similar methods to keep any condensation from the skin of

the
tank is a good idea.

Mild steel is generally not painted inside and the steel tanks do last at
least 20 years (the diesel on the inside tends to give a nice coating).
That said you can coat the inside of steel tanks for additional

protection.

No I wouldn't use stainless steel - generally weld cracking can occur with
the thin plates of tanks. If you do go S.S., I would probably select

316L,
which is a low carbon version of 316 that is suited for welding. Much
better for corrosion than 304. But it's a pretty big price premium for
doubtful benefit.
